Does it feel real jerky down low and unresponsive and low rpms then fine when you get on it and get into higher rpms?
Do the water spray test on the headers after the bike has been runnin for a bit and see if all of them are working.

change the plugs and check your battery terminals. My f4i's used to get corroded battery terminals and it would run like ****. get some sandpaper and scuff the ends of the cables and battery terminals. Also check the ground wire where it grounds to the engine.

If the two center cylinders don't pass the spray test its going to be your fuel pressure regulator. Pull the plugs and look at them. If they are all dark and wet it means the fuel pressure regulator is busted and is dumpin too much gas into those cylinders cuasin the bike to ride like ****.
